1.เกริ่น
Submitted by wd on 21 November, 2007 - 13:01.
เชลล์สคริปต์ พูดง่าย ๆ ก็คือการนำคำสั่งในเชลล์ของลินุกซ์มาเรียงต่อกันให้ทำงานตามที่เราต้องการ โดยเพิ่มโครงสร้างการวนรอบ และฟังก์ชั่นต่าง ๆ เติมเข้ามา เพื่อให้การทำงานได้ตามที่เราต้องการ ซึ่งจะเหมาะมากกับงานแบบ batch หรืองานแบบ schedule
ฉะนั้นการที่จะเขียนโค้ดให้ได้ดี จึงต้องศึกษาจดจำคำสั่งต่าง ๆ ของเชลล์ให้ได้เท่าที่เราต้องการใช้งาน (จำหมดคงไม่ไหว)
คำสั่งต่าง ๆ สามารถดูได้ที่ gnu.org: Bash Reference Manual
สำหรับเดเบียน หากต้องการใช้งาน bash แบบเต็มรูป (ไม่อั้นความสามารถ) อาจต้องปรับแต่งเล็กน้อย
เปลี่ยนให้เชลล์ของเราเป็น bash แทน sh ใช้คำสั่ง
$ chsh -s /bin/bash
สำหรับเอดิเตอร์ ถ้าใช้ vi ควรติดตั้ง vim-full และอย่าลืมแก้ไขไฟล์ vimrc ให้แสดงสีด้วย เพื่อให้ดูโค๊ดได้ง่ายขึ้น
$ sudo aptitude install vim-full $ vi ~/.vimrc
syntax on
:wq













Re: 1.เกริ่น
คำสั่งเปลี่ยนเชลล์สำหรับผู้ใช้ธรรมดา น่าจะใช้ chsh ไหมครับ ไม่ต้อง sudo
Re: 1.เกริ่น
ขอบคุณมากครับ เปลี่ยนต้นฉบับเรียบร้อยแล้วครับ
Re: 1.เกริ่น
เพิ่มเติมครับ: chsh เปลี่ยนเชลล์ของตัวเอง ไม่ต้องใส่ USERNAME นะครับ
Re: 1.เกริ่น
ขอบคุณอีกครั้งครับ เปลี่ยนต้นฉบับเรียบร้อย
Post new comment